Botanical tea
Sip on a warm cup of sleepy time tea. Some favourites include chamomile, lavender, passionflower and valerian root.
Journaling
This is the perfect time to journal anything that is on your mind so you don't go to bed with a busy mind thinking of all the things you have to do tomorrow.
Climb into bed tech-free
Turn off screens an hour before bed and keep on silent. Slip into bed and mindfully relax your muscles starting head to toes, breath slowly — in for 4, out for 6 — to settle your mind.
